In a garden in Ohrid, a tomato of one kilogram



The Ohrid variety of tomato, the famous “Ohridski jabuchar” has long been missing from home meals, but in Boris Gjorgjioski’s garden in Ohrid is ripen giant tomato, weighing almost one kilogram.

He says that the tomato is completely environmentally, while on the same root there were six tomatoes, smaller than this one for some 100 grams.
Boris noted that the tomato is not at all sprayed with pesticides or other preservatives that contain chemicals and are harmful for the human health.

-It is not raised nor fertilizer. Only is undernourished and sprayed against pests with boiled nettle tea, while the irrigation system is drip with spring water or still water, which does not contain chlorine, noted Gjorgjioski.
The secret of this giant and tasty tomato, as explained, is the timely preparation of spraying with nettles and timely irrigation.

In Dubai opened supermarket with Macedonian products


OCTOBER 16, 2013BY KURIR.MKIN MACEDONIACOMMENTS

Last weekend in Dubai was opened a supermarket EuroBalcan Shop, which in its offer includes products from many Macedonian-known domestic brands.

Ajvar, malidzhano and apricot jam of “Diem”, the products of “Vipro”, the famous pickles of “Macedonia”, the peppers with kaper of “Agronova” are only part of Macedonian products and brands that since the last weekend can be brought in Dubai at the newly opened supermarket.
In fact, this is the first supermarket in the Middle East. With its opening, our people living in the UAE now have the opportunity to taste Macedonian food at any time, and Macedonian producers, however, it is an opportunity for export and marketing of new products to market with great potential.

 
Macedonian wines conquer the UK market


Tikveš wines Smederevka – Rkatsiteli and Vranec – Merlot are already on sale in 156 stores of the famous chain supermarkets “Marks and Spencer”, and sold in high price segment, which is further confirmation of the quality of the wines.

The first shipment to UK BB ​​”Tikveš” was completed in September, and the wines were placed on the shelves in the “Marks and Spencer” this month. In the next period a new shipment is expected to follow, announced from “Tikveš “.
About the sale of the ​​”Tikveš” wines in the famous commercial chain “Marks and Spencer” in the UK, the leading British newspaper “The Times” wrote an article entitled “Alexander the grape invades M & S”. The author makes an association to Macedonia and writes for the production of the Macedonian wine, emphasizing the long tradition of wine producing since ancient times.
Our priority as a leading winery in the region, as stated from ​​”Tikveš”, is to provide a ranking of our wines at the most prestigious markets.
BB ​​”Tikveš” sales more than 60 percent of the total production of wines to foreign markets. Apart from the markets in the region, the ​​”Tikveš” wines are sold in the U.S. and at the Europe market. Preparations for entering the Chinese market are in the final stage. Using the best global knowledge and experience, sophisticated technology, continued investment and promotion, contributed to a significant increase in exports of the ​​”Tikveš” wines on high competitive markets, such as markets in the UK, U.S. and Scandinavia. During this year ​​”Tikveš” wines won over 40 awards at prestigious international competitions.
As a result of increased exports, BB ​​”Tikveš” bought 50 percent more grapes this year compared to last year, or 25,000 pounds of grapes. With a capacity of over 35 million gallons of production and storage of wine, BB ​​”Tikveš” is one of the largest wineries in South Eastern Europe. The average annual production is around 15 million liters, according to the statement from ​​”Tikveš”.
